Public bug reported: Binary package hint: ntfs-3g
Release 1.2216-1ubuntu1 is built against external fuse libraries, and breaks mounting ntfs partitions as user (including external USB drives). While previously it could be set suid root, as per bug #162863, to allow mounting by an unprivileged user, with the change to external fuse libs that no longer is possible.
